Dahlia is simplifying (3t)^4 using these steps:

(3t)^4= 3t*3t*3t*3t=3*3*3*3*t*t*t*t


Although Dahlia is correct so far, which step could she have used instead to simplify the expression ?

A. 3t^4=3t^4
B.3^4t=81t
C. 4(3t)=12t
D.3^4t^4=81t^4

Dahlia could have raised both the coefficient and variable to the power of 4

Simplifying exponential functions

Given the exponential expression as shown below;

(3t)^4

This shows that we are to multiply 3t in 4 places to have;

(3t)^4 = (3t) * 3t * 3t * 3t

(3t)^4 = 3^4 * t^4

(3t)^4 = 81t^4

This shows that Dahlia could have raised both the coefficient and variable to the power of 4
